Output 56c95554fc13c4b895333e24e51b31fb8b382c040f06822eb71f62f264a945de:1

value
89031331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86f7c01650d0467383e2f85eee9dd833373a17ed OP_EQUAL
address
3DzfGF8ekJEVnby9HaL8RJmUVbVNeT3rMR
transaction
56c95554fc13c4b895333e24e51b31fb8b382c040f06822eb71f62f264a945de
spent
true